P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: Tastaturprobleme nach dem Editieren


e@sy
23.12.2005, 03:01
Das Problem tritt bisher nur unter Firefox 1.5 Final auf.

Wird ein Beitrag über die Schnelländerung editiert, funktionieren nach dem Speichern der Änderung die Pfeiltasten auf der Tastatur nicht mehr. Der geänderte Beitrag kann also nicht mehr über die Tastatur gescrollt werden. Erst wenn das Forum und dann der Beitrag neu aufgerufen wird, funktionieren die Tasten wieder. Oder nach einem aktualisieren der Seite durch f5.

Tal_
24.12.2005, 07:39
Das kann ich bestätigen, ist bei mir mit FF 1.5 auch so.

Substanz
25.12.2005, 11:56
Ach damit hängt das zusammen! Ich habe mich schon gewundert...

Andreas
27.12.2005, 18:46
http://www.vbulletin.com/forum/bugs35.php?do=view&bugid=2017


--- clientscript/vbulletin_quick_edit.js
+++ clientscript/vbulletin_quick_edit.js
@@ -200,7 +200,7 @@ vB_AJAX_QuickEditor.prototype.display_ed
*/
vB_AJAX_QuickEditor.prototype.restore = function(post_html, type)
{
- this.hide_errors();
+ this.hide_errors(true);
if (this.editorid && vB_Editor[this.editorid] && vB_Editor[this.editorid].initialized)
{
vB_Editor[this.editorid].destroy();
@@ -401,11 +401,14 @@ vB_AJAX_QuickEditor.prototype.show_error
/**
* Hide the error window
*/
-vB_AJAX_QuickEditor.prototype.hide_errors = function()
+vB_AJAX_QuickEditor.prototype.hide_errors = function(skip_focus_check)
{
this.errors = false;
fetch_object('ajax_post_errors').style.display = 'none';
- vB_Editor[this.editorid].check_focus();
+ if (skip_focus_check != true)
+ {
+ vB_Editor[this.editorid].check_focus();
+ }
};

e@sy
27.12.2005, 19:28
Besten Dank

Tal_
28.12.2005, 09:16
danke dir, es funktioniert jetzt

Substanz
28.12.2005, 10:43
An welche Stelle kommt den der obige Codeschnipsel?

e@sy
28.12.2005, 11:09
An welche Stelle kommt den der obige Codeschnipsel?

Die Datei steht drin (vbulletin_quick_edit.js)
gesucht wird nach der - Zeile, diese wird durch die +zeile ersetzt.

Tal_
28.12.2005, 17:07
sind 2 verschiedene Stellen in der Datei wo du das ändern mußt

schaue auf deinem Server nach im Unterverzeichnis vom Forum: clientscript und da die Datei vbulletin_quick_edit.js ,
da must du die Änderungen machen und wie e@sy schrieb die Zeilen mit - mit denen mit + ersetzen, weiterhin die mit + hinzufügen